The price of martha's meal was $10, and she left a tip that was r percent of the price of her meal. Sam left a tip that was s percent of the price of his meal. If Martha and Sam each left a tip of $1.50, what was the price of Sam's meal?

(1) s=20
20xs%=1.5
20xs=150
s=7.5
Sufficient

(2) s=4/3*r
10xr%=1.5
10xr/100=1.5
10r=150
r=15

s=4/3x15
s=20
Sufficient

Answer: D.
